Web29 Jan 2024 · Bake for 40-45 minutes until crispy. While the wings are cooking, make the sauce. Add the honey, soy sauce, garlic, ginger, and water to a small pot. Bring it to a boil and reduce the heat to low letting it simmer for 10 minutes – or until slightly reduced and thickened. Remove the sauce from the heat and let it cool.

Prep. Preheat your oven to 425F. Dry the wings. Pat the chicken wings with a paper towel or kitchen towel to dry them off. Make the seasoning. Add the salt, pepper, paprika, garlic, onion, and baking powder to a bowl, and stir to combine.
